mongodb条件查询 公共查询条件:{<key1>:<value1>,……},多条件时进行与(and)(or)条件查询*/ //查询《 C语言编程》这条文档的信息
时间: 2024-09-27 12:07:28 浏览: 23
MongoDB的条件查询通常使用`find()`方法,并通过`$match`阶段来设置筛选规则。如果要查询《C语言编程》这本书的相关信息,你可以构造如下的查询:
```javascript
db.books.find({
title: 'C语言编程', // 查询书籍标题
// 可能还有其他公共查询条件,例如作者、出版年份等
author: '<author_name>', // 如果需要匹配特定作者
publication_year: <year> // 如果需要匹配特定出版年份
})
```
如果你想进行多条件的查询,可以使用`$and`操作符(与条件),将每个条件放在一个数组里:
```javascript
db.books.find({
$and: [
{title: 'C语言编程'},
{author: '<author_name>'},
{publication_year: <year>}
]
})
```
或者使用`$or`操作符(或条件),当满足其中一个条件时就返回结果:
```javascript
db.books.find({
$or: [
{title: 'C语言编程', author: '<author_name>'},
{title: 'C语言编程', publication_year: <year>}
]
})
```
请注意替换`<author_name>`和`<year>`为你实际想要匹配的值。
阅读全文